What Is Health?

The concept of health is a complex one. It refers to the physical, mental, social, and environmental resources of an individual. Whether the health is poor or good depends on the individual’s resources. Public health is about prevention and control of disease. It includes preventing illness through awareness and education. For example, public health aims to prevent and control disease through various means, including regular checkups, vaccination programs, and safe drinking water. In addition, it encourages healthy lifestyles, such as eating healthy foods, exercising regularly, and condom use.

The World Health Organization’s constitution states that “the enjoyment of the highest possible standard of health is a fundamental human right.” It has been endorsed by a number of nation states, which makes it a legal obligation for those states to provide timely, affordable, and adequate health care. The constitution also outlines the determinants of good health, such as education, access to clean water, and access to sanitation and hygiene.
